Lynx JS: The New Kid on the Block
Lynx JS is a cross-platform framework launched by ByteDance (yep, TikTokโs parent company) in 2025. Itโs built with Rustโa super-fast programming languageโand uses JavaScript, CSS, and React to create apps that work on phones, web browsers, and more. Think of it as a speedy, modern way to build apps with a web vibe but near-native power.
Kotlin: The Reliable Veteran
Kotlin, created by JetBrains, has been around since 2011 and became a big deal for Android apps. With Kotlin Multiplatform (KMP), it now works across Android, iOS, and even web apps. Itโs tied to the Java Virtual Machine (JVM) but can also compile into native code. Itโs like a Swiss Army knife for developers who want flexibility and deep control.

Lynx JS vs. Kotlin: Performance Showdown
When it comes to app development, performance is king. How fast does your app start? How smooth is the screen? Letโs see how Lynx JS and Kotlin stack up.
Startup Speed: Whoโs Quicker Off the Line?
- Lynx JS: On Android, it kicks off in just 420 milliseconds (ms) for a cold startโwhen the app launches from scratch. On iOS, itโs even snappier at 220ms for a warm start (reopening an app).
- Kotlin Multiplatform: Itโs a bit slower, taking 580ms on Android and 310ms on iOS. Native Kotlin (without KMP) is faster at 380ms, but KMP adds some overhead.
Winner: Lynx JS. Itโs 27.6% faster on Android cold starts, thanks to Rust and pre-warmed JavaScript tricks. If your app needs to feel instant, Lynx has the edge.
UI Rendering: Smooth Moves or Stutter Steps?
- Lynx JS: Hits a near-perfect 59.8 frames per second (FPS) when scrolling a social media feed. It drops only 12 frames in 60 seconds and responds to taps in 48ms.
- Kotlin Multiplatform: Manages 57.2 FPS with 34 frame drops and an 82ms touch delay. Its Compose Multiplatform tool struggles a bit with layouts.
Winner: Lynx JS again. Its multi-threaded design keeps animations silky smoothโperfect for apps where looks matter.
Heavy Lifting: Crunching Numbers
For a big math task (multiplying two 1024ร1024 matrices):
- Lynx JS: Finishes in 1.8 seconds using its WebAssembly (WASM) backend.
- Kotlin Multiplatform: Takes 2.1 seconds with Kotlin/Native.
Winner: Lynx JS by 14.3%. Itโs not a huge gap, but it shows Rustโs muscle flexing.
Resource Usage: Whoโs Lighter on Your Phone?
Nobody likes an app that drains their battery or hogs memory. Hereโs how these two compare.
Memory Footprint
- Lynx JS: Uses 28MB on Android startup and peaks at 148MB for heavy tasks. Its Rust engine keeps things tight.
- Kotlin Multiplatform: Starts at 45MB and climbs to 210MB. The JVM adds extra baggage.
Winner: Lynx JS. Itโs 19โ41% leaner, making it great for budget phones or lightweight apps.
Battery Life
- Lynx JS: Drains 12% of your battery per hour with fewer โjankyโ frames (0.8% stutter).
- Kotlin Multiplatform: Uses 18% per hour with 2.1% jankโthose tiny freezes you feel when scrolling.
Winner: Lynx JS. Less power draw and smoother performance mean happier users.
Heat Check
- Lynx JS: Raises your phoneโs CPU temp by 4.2ยฐC during heavy use.
- Kotlin Multiplatform: Pushes it up 6.8ยฐCโouch!
Winner: Lynx JS. Its smaller binary size (23% less code) keeps things cool.
Native Power: Talking to Your Phoneโs Core
Sometimes, apps need to dig deep into a phoneโs systemโlike using the camera or GPS. This is where โnative API accessโ comes in.
- Lynx JS: Takes 0.8ms on Android and 1.1ms on iOS to call native features. It uses a C++/JavaScript mix to get close to the metal.
- Kotlin Multiplatform: Blazes at 0.3ms on Android and 0.9ms on iOS. Its โexpected/actualโ setup is nearly instant.
Winner: Kotlin. Itโs built for this stuff, especially on Android, where itโs practically family.
Development Efficiency: Building Your App Fast
Performance is only half the story. How easy is it to make your app? Letโs check the tools and support.
Ecosystem and Libraries
- Lynx JS: Still young with 12 production apps (think TikTok features) and 127 third-party libraries. Itโs growing fast but feels new.
- Kotlin Multiplatform: A heavyweight with 480+ apps and 2,300+ libraries. JetBrainsโ toolsโlike kotlinx-benchmarkโmake life easy.
Winner: Kotlin. Its mature ecosystem is a dream for big teams.
Learning Curve
- Lynx JS: If you know JavaScript, CSS, and React, youโre golden. Itโs web-friendly and approachable.
- Kotlin Multiplatform: Steeper if youโre new to JVM or native coding, but Android devs slide right in.
Winner: Tie. Depends on your backgroundโweb devs pick Lynx, Android pros pick Kotlin.
Team Workflow
- Lynx JS: Partial CI/CD (continuous integration/deployment) support means more manual work.
- Kotlin Multiplatform: Full CI/CD integrationโperfect for enterprise pipelines.
Winner: Kotlin. Itโs ready for serious business.
